The Weight of Expectations

In today’s society, beauty standards are often dictated by airbrushed magazine covers, flawlessly curated social media feeds, and celebrities promoting an idealized version of attractiveness. People are bombarded with images that suggest only a certain body type, skin tone, or facial structure is worthy of admiration. As a result, countless individuals battle insecurities, feeling as though they fall short of an unattainable ideal.

Amelia was one of them. From a young age, she was acutely aware that she looked different from her peers. She wasn’t thin like the girls on TV or in fashion ads. She was bigger, and while that hadn’t seemed to matter when she was a child, things changed as she grew older. Comments that once felt harmless became cruel jabs, and strangers felt entitled to judge her based on nothing more than her appearance.

Her mother, who had noticed Amelia’s size from an early age, worried about the world’s reaction to her daughter. Society tends to be unforgiving to those who don’t fit its rigid beauty mold. At first, Amelia didn’t let it affect her much. But as the years passed, the whispers turned into outright mockery, and the stares became impossible to ignore. She learned to shrink herself, not physically, but emotionally—retreating into her own world, hiding from the judgment she faced daily.

Finding Solace in a Digital World

As social gatherings became more painful, Amelia sought comfort elsewhere. She found escape in video games, where no one cared about her weight, where she could be anyone she wanted to be. In the digital world, she wasn’t judged by her appearance—only by her skills, her wit, and her kindness.

Still, she yearned for real human connection, for someone who would see beyond her body and appreciate the person she was inside. She had convinced herself that love was something meant for other people—those who fit into the neat little boxes society had created.

And then, she met Sean.

Love That Defied Expectations

Sean wasn’t like the others. He didn’t see Amelia as just a body—he saw her heart, her laughter, her intelligence, and her kindness. Where others had judged, he admired. Where others had criticized, he uplifted. From the moment they met, he made Amelia feel seen in a way she had never experienced before.

Their love grew naturally, despite the world’s doubts. When they held hands in public, they could hear the murmurs, the disapproving looks from strangers who believed love should come in a certain package. People whispered cruel things, assuming Sean was with Amelia out of pity or some ulterior motive.

But none of that mattered. What they had was real. And when Sean got down on one knee and proposed, Amelia realized something—she had spent so much of her life trying to prove her worth to the world, but with Sean, she never had to. She was enough, just as she was.

Turning Criticism into a Movement

Their wedding was intimate, surrounded only by those who truly loved and supported them. But what started as a personal love story soon became something much bigger. When Amelia and Sean shared their journey online, they never expected it to go viral. Yet, within days, their story spread across the globe, touching hearts and challenging deeply ingrained beauty biases.

People who had spent their lives feeling unworthy found hope in Amelia and Sean’s love. Their story shattered the illusion that love is reserved for those who meet certain beauty standards. Instead, it proved that love is about connection, respect, and seeing each other for who they truly are.

Hate still existed. The internet can be a cruel place, and not everyone was ready to accept that beauty isn’t one-size-fits-all. But for every negative comment, there were thousands of messages from people who felt inspired, who finally saw themselves reflected in a love story that didn’t fit Hollywood’s mold.

Changing the Narrative

Over time, Amelia and Sean turned their personal journey into a movement. They spoke out against body shaming, encouraged self-love, and worked to redefine beauty in a way that was inclusive of all people. They reminded the world that love isn’t about fitting into a societal expectation—it’s about finding someone who loves you for who you are.

Their journey became proof that happiness doesn’t come from conforming to impossible standards. It comes from embracing yourself fully and finding people who appreciate you—not in spite of your differences, but because of them.

Amelia once feared she would never be loved. Now, she and Sean stand as living proof that love knows no size, no shape, no restrictions. Their story is more than just a romance—it’s a revolution.
